简介:本文将介绍HTML中关于文本的元素以及CSS如何处理字体。通过了解这些基础知识,你可以更好地控制网页中的文本样式,提高用户体验。
在HTML中,我们使用各种元素来处理文本。最基本的元素是<p>,它表示一个段落。例如:
<p>这是一个段落。</p>
此外,还有许多其他元素可用于处理文本,例如:
<h1>到<h6>:表示六个不同级别的标题,<h1>最大,<h6>最小。<em>:表示强调文本。浏览器通常会使用斜体显示它。<strong>:表示重要文本。浏览器通常会使用粗体显示它。<a>:表示超链接。你可以使用它来链接到其他网页或网页上的特定部分。<img>:表示图像。你可以使用它来插入图片。font-family属性来设置字体。例如,如果你想使用Times New Roman字体,你可以这样写:在这个例子中,如果浏览器不能显示Times New Roman字体,它会尝试显示Times字体,如果还是不能显示,它会回退到任何可用的衬线字体(serif)。
p {font-family: 'Times New Roman', Times, serif;}
font-size属性来设置字体大小。例如,如果你想将所有段落的字体大小设置为16像素,你可以这样写:
p {font-size: 16px;}
color属性来设置字体颜色。例如,如果你想将所有段落的字体颜色设置为蓝色,你可以这样写:
p {color: blue;}
text-align属性来设置文本对齐方式。例如,如果你想将所有段落居中对齐,你可以这样写:
p {text-align: center;}
text-decoration属性来添加下划线、删除线或上划线等装饰。例如,如果你想为所有链接添加下划线,你可以这样写:
a {text-decoration: underline;}
text-transform属性来转换文本的大小写。例如,如果你想将所有标题转换为全大写,你可以这样写:
h1, h2, h3, h4, h5, h6 {text-transform: uppercase;}
line-height属性来设置行高。例如,如果你想将所有段落的行高设置为1.5倍的字体大小,你可以这样写:这些只是CSS中处理文本的一些基本方法。通过组合这些方法,你可以创建出非常复杂的样式效果。
p {line-height: 1.5;}